Sign up to access all features of our service.
  • Job search
  • Favorites
  • Create a CV
    New
  • Salaries
  • Subscriptions

Senior Flight Software Engineer II - Automation & Test

CesiumAstro

Job Description

Job Description

Please Note:  To conform with the United States Government Space Technology Export Regulations, the applicant must be a U.S. citizen, lawful permanent resident of the U.S., conditional resident, asylee or refugee (protected individuals as defined by 8 U.S.C. 1324b(a)(3)), or eligible to obtain the required authorizations from the U.S. Department of State.

 

At  CesiumAstro , we are developers and pioneers of out-of-the-box communication systems for satellites, UAVs, launch vehicles, and other space and airborne platforms. We take pride in our dynamic and cross-functional work environment, which allows us to learn, develop, and engage across our organization. If you are looking for hands-on, interactive, and autonomous work, CesiumAstro is the place for you. We are actively seeking passionate, collaborative, energetic, and forward-thinking individuals to join our team.

We are looking to add a Senior Flight Software Engineer II - Automation & Test to our Satellite team.  If you are excited about automated testing of spacecraft software systems and thrive in a startup environment where you own your path, we want to hear from you.

 

In this role, you will be responsible for creating automated testing systems that enable rapid delivery of satellite software and hardware to ensure that software releases perform reliably – on both simulation environments and integrated hardware platforms.  You will have ownership over the projects you are working on, all the way from an idea to deployment.  You will work closely with flight software, hardware, systems, and integration teams to validate functionality, performance, and stability across the full development lifecycle.

 

As a CesiumAstro spacecraft team member, you will work on a small team to develop satellites and put them in orbit. Your work will have a direct impact on the success of the company. You will work closely with the engineering team, program management to ensure the successful build and launch of our satellite. Element will be the largest, most powerful rideshare satellite in LEO. We’re launching eight of them in the next four years, starting with our first launch this year.  Together, our small team will design, build, and iterate to reduce mass and cost while increasing performance, reliability, and manufacturability of a new generation of satellites. Let’s build! 

JOB DUTIES AND RESPONSIBILITIES
  • Design and implement an automated testing ecosystem to verify CesiumAstro satellite flight software and satellite systems.
  • Develop, execute, and maintain test scripts to validate software functionality on flatsat, Hardware-in-the-loop (HIL) systems and simulated systems.
  • Create complex testing automation plans using industry standard languages and frameworks.
  • Create test plans aligned to validate system requirements and mission objectives.
  • Integrate automated tests into CI/CD pipelines to support rapid iteration during release cycles.
  • Analyze test results to provide clear, actionable feedback to engineering teams.
  • Work with engineers across all teams at CesiumAstro to debug, investigate, and document hardware and software defects.
  • Improve test coverage, execution efficiency, and reliability over time.
  • Identify areas of improvement on our test automation posture across the organization.
JOB REQUIREMENTS AND MINIMUM QUALIFICATIONS
  • Bachelor of Science (BS), Master of Science (MS), or Doctorate (PhD) degree in Software or Computer Engineering from an accredited university or institution.
  • Minimum of 6 years of industry experience in spacecraft software development.
  • Experience writing automated testing scripts with Python, C, or C++.
  • Experience with OpenC3 COSMOS software for operations and test automation
  • Strong debugging, troubleshooting, and root-cause analysis skills.
  • Strong communication and organization skills.
PREFERRED EXPERIENCE
  • Experience testing software on hardware test platforms (HIL, flatsat, integration benches, or similar).
  • Experience with Linux, Single Board Computers, embedded computers, and FPGAs.
  • Experience using git, Continuous Integration, and monitoring tools to fully automate validation and testing during development.
  • Experience with containerization tools like Docker.
  • Deployment of testing software used in real-world applications.
  • Fundamental knowledge of communication protocols (UART, SPI, I2C, Ethernet, CAN, etc.)
  • Familiarity with requirements traceability tools.
  • Understanding of mission-critical or safety-critical software validation.
  • Basic experience with RF and electrical engineering lab equipment for testing and debugging.

CesiumAstro considers several factors when extending an offer, including but not limited to, the role and associated responsibilities, a candidate’s work experience, education/training, and key skills.  Full-time employment offers include company stock options and a generous benefits package including health, dental, vision, HSA, FSA, life, disability and retirement plans.  

 

CesiumAstro is an Equal Opportunity employer.  All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, national origin, disability, protected Veteran Status, or any other characteristic protected by applicable federal, state, or local law.

 

Please note: CesiumAstro does not accept unsolicited resumes from contract agencies or search firms. Any unsolicited resumes submitted to our website or to CesiumAstro team members will be considered property of CesiumAstro, and we will not be obligated to pay any referral fees.

We may use artificial intelligence (AI) tools to support parts of the hiring process, such as reviewing applications, analyzing resumes, or assessing responses and identifying potential inconsistencies or verification signals in application materials based on available information. These tools assist our recruitment team but do not replace human judgment. Final hiring decisions are ultimately made by humans. If you would like more information about how your data is processed, please contact us.

Vacancy posted a month ago
Similar jobs that could be interesting for youBased on the Senior Flight Software Engineer II - Automation & Test in Westminster, CO vacancy
  • $133k - $161k

    Senior Test Software Engineer II Design and maintain automated test systems for embedded hardware and firmware. Location: Westminster, Colorado, United States Compensation: $133,000 - 161,000 USD / year Job Tags: Software About The Role Senior Test Software Engineer... 
    Senior
    Full time
    Contract work
    Work experience placement
    Local area

    jobs.frontdoordefense.com - Jobboard

    Westminster, CO
    3 days ago
  • CesiumAstro seeks a Senior Flight Software Engineer II for the Internal Missions team, located in Westminster, Colorado. The role involves designing...  ...with responsibilities including software development, testing, and customer support. Ideal candidates will have a strong... 
    Senior

    Roman Health Pharmacy LLC

    Westminster, CO
    1 day ago
  •  ...individuals to join our team. We are looking to add a Senior Flight Software Engineer II to our Internal Missions team. If you enjoy working in...  ...satellite flight software and software-in-the-loop testing through all stages of the development process. Your work... 
    Senior
    Permanent employment
    Full time
    Contract work
    Work experience placement
    Local area

    CesiumAstro

    Westminster, CO
    4 days ago
  • $133k - $160k

     ...seeking passionate, collaborative, energetic, and forward‑thinking individuals to join our team. We are seeking a Senior Software Engineer - Test Automation & Infrastructure to develop and scale automated test systems supporting the validation of complex RF and... 
    Senior
    Permanent employment
    Full time
    Work experience placement
    Local area

    Roman Health Pharmacy LLC

    Westminster, CO
    1 day ago
  • $113k - $136k

     ...thinking individuals to join our team. We are seeking a Senior Flight Dynamics Engineer II to lead orbit design, trajectory analysis, and orbit determination...  ...flight dynamics tools and simulation environments. Automate analysis workflows to scale with company growth.... 
    Senior
    Permanent employment
    Full time
    Contract work
    Work experience placement
    Local area

    Roman Health Pharmacy LLC

    Westminster, CO
    2 days ago
  • $133k - $161k

    CesiumAstro is hiring a Senior Test Software Engineer II located in Westminster, Colorado. You will design and maintain automated test systems for embedded hardware and firmware, ensuring products are reliable and ready for production. This role requires a Bachelor's or... 
    Senior

    jobs.frontdoordefense.com - Jobboard

    Westminster, CO
    3 days ago
  • $134k - $161k

     ...join our team. We are looking to add a Senior RF Test Engineer II to our team. If you enjoy working in...  ...a strong combination of hardware and software knowledge with proficiencies in RF...  ...VNAs, etc.), test architectures, and automation. The successful candidate will work closely... 
    Senior
    Permanent employment
    Full time
    Work experience placement
    Local area

    Roman Health Pharmacy LLC

    Westminster, CO
    10 hours ago
  • $150k - $190k

     ...You'll Do # Support spacecraft flight test by executing fault detection test campaigns...  ...verification tests, and flight software sequencing tests # Build an understanding...  ...and contribute to the iteration of other engineers' code with technical rigor through code... 
    Senior
    Relocation package
    Weekend work

    Katalyst Space Technologies

    Broomfield, CO
    5 days ago
  • Flight Software Engineer II page is loaded## Flight Software Engineer IIlocations: Greater Seattle Area...  ...role in designing, developing, testing, and deploying embedded flight software...  ...Build and run unit, integration, and automated regression tests across Software-in-the... 
    Permanent employment
    Temporary work
    Local area
    Relocation package

    Blue Origin

    Denver, CO
    50 minutes ago
  • $140k - $250k

     ...Sr. Flight Software Engineer Denver, CO or Long Beach, CA True Anomaly seeks...  ...Your mission: As a Senior Flight Software Engineer at...  ..., analysis, manufacturing, test, and flight. The company culture...  ...in areas such as robotics, automation, motor control, and sensor... 
    Senior

    True Anomaly

    Denver, CO
    17 hours ago
  • $133k - $161k

     ...product line is focused on the rapid design, build, and test of cutting‑edge active phased array antennas (AESA) for terrestrial...  ...connectivity solutions. We are seeking an experienced Senior Embedded Software Engineer II with a strong background in developing embedded... 
    Senior
    Permanent employment
    Full time
    Contract work
    Work experience placement
    Local area

    Roman Health Pharmacy LLC

    Westminster, CO
    2 days ago
  • A leading space software company is seeking a Senior Flight Software Engineer I to join their Internal Missions team. You will be responsible for developing software for pioneering satellite communications. Ideal candidates have at least 4 years of spacecraft software development... 
    Senior

    Roman Health Pharmacy LLC

    Westminster, CO
    3 days ago
  • $158k - $200k

     ...We are looking to add a Principal RF Test Engineer II to our team. If you enjoy working in a...  ...a strong combination of hardware and software knowledge with proficiencies in RF measurements...  ...VNAs, etc.), test architectures, and automation. The successful candidate will work... 
    Permanent employment
    Full time
    Work experience placement
    Local area

    Roman Health Pharmacy LLC

    Westminster, CO
    1 day ago
  • $133k - $160k

    CesiumAstro, based in Colorado, is seeking a Senior Software Engineer - Test Automation & Infrastructure. This role is vital for developing automated test systems for RF and satellite communications. The ideal candidate will have extensive experience in test automation... 
    Senior

    Roman Health Pharmacy LLC

    Westminster, CO
    2 days ago
  • A leading aerospace company in Colorado is looking for a Senior Flight Dynamics Engineer II to lead orbit design and trajectory analysis. The role involves ensuring orbital safety, conducting mission analysis, and collaborating with engineering teams for satellite operations... 
    Senior

    Roman Health Pharmacy LLC

    Westminster, CO
    2 days ago
  • Blue Origin LLC in Denver is seeking an Embedded Software Engineer II to develop software for the Blue Ring spacecraft. This role is crucial for ensuring the flight software is effective and integrates properly within the hybrid propulsion system. The ideal candidate should... 
    Relocation package

    Blue Origin

    Denver, CO
    1 day ago
  • GovCIO is seeking a skilled Test Engineer to design and implement testing methods during the software development process. This fully remote position requires experience in manual and automated testing, along with proficiency in tools like Jira and AWS. The ideal candidate... 
    Senior
    Remote job
    Flexible hours

    GovCIO

    Denver, CO
    2 days ago
  • CesiumAstro in Westminster, Colorado is seeking a Senior RF Test Engineer II to develop critical test systems for aerospace communication. The ideal candidate should have a strong background in RF measurements and test architecture design, with at least 6 years of industry... 
    Senior
    Full time

    Roman Health Pharmacy LLC

    Westminster, CO
    4 days ago
  • $197.4k - $232k

     ...Location Type: Remote Department Engineering Compensation: $197.4K – $232K •...  ...Platform. About the Role Senior Software Engineers II at Confluent take ownership of...  ...productivity improvements (tooling, automation, process) that raise the bar for the... 
    Senior
    Full time
    Remote work

    Confluent

    Denver, CO
    1 day ago
  • A leading aerospace solutions firm is seeking a Senior Software Engineer-Test Focused in the Greater Denver Metro Area. This individual will play a crucial role in integration efforts and software testing, with a focus on embedded C++. The ideal candidate has at least 8... 
    Senior

    Trusted Space, Inc.

    Denver, CO
    2 days ago
  • $156k - $224k

     ...Corps is seeking candidates for a position that requires an active TS/SCI clearance with Polygraph. The role involves developing automated testing for full stack web applications, participating in verification methodologies, and overseeing mission requirements management.... 

    International Executive Service Corps

    Westminster, CO
    2 days ago
  • $165k - $200k

    Senior Software Engineer-Test Focused (Chantilly, VA; Denver Metro Area; ...) Position Title: Senior Software Engineer-Test Focused Requisition...  ...integration test scripts to use as a design for developing automated regression tests Qualifications Bachelor’s degree or... 
    Senior
    Temporary work
    Local area

    Trusted Space, Inc.

    Denver, CO
    10 hours ago
  • About the Role We're hiring a Senior Software Engineer to take on meaningful ownership of our platform...  ...design through implementation, testing, and deployment Collaborate directly...  ...practices Bonus: You have experience automating workflows, using Playwright, Slack bots... 
    Senior
    Temporary work
    Work at office
    Local area
    Remote work

    Elea Ecuador

    Denver, CO
    4 days ago
  •  ...Job Description Job Description About the Manufacturing + Test Engineer Position Job Description: The Manufacturing + Test...  ...Engineering or related area. ~2-10 years of experience (Eng II or Senior/III) in an aerospace manufacturing and test environment preferred... 

    M.M.A. Design LLC

    Broomfield, CO
    19 days ago
  • Blue Origin LLC in Denver, Colorado is seeking a Flight Software Engineer III to design and develop embedded flight software for spacecraft systems supporting national security. This role demands proficiency in C/C++ and experience with real-time systems, alongside a passion... 
    Senior

    Blue Origin

    Denver, CO
    10 hours ago
  •  ...not just building an app—we’re building unstoppable teams. So what do you say, are you in? Your Impact Starts Here As a Senior Software Engineer II on our Identity & Notifications team, you'll own the systems that power Homebase's "Passport to Work" vision — the... 
    Senior
    Hourly pay
    Full time
    Temporary work
    Work at office
    Local area
    Flexible hours

    Homebase

    Denver, CO
    3 hours ago
  • $100k - $150k

     ...(*Comscore, Total Visits, March 2025) Day to Day As a Software Engineer II on the Meta Profile team, you will design and build scalable...  ...unlawful in Massachusetts to require or administer a lie detector test as a condition of employment or continued employment. An... 
    Work experience placement
    Local area

    Indeed

    Denver, CO
    5 days ago
  • $91.7k - $115k

     ...in people's lives. Our medical devices, software and related services are used worldwide...  ...software designs, source code, and unit tests for product software or supporting software...  .... Stays current with software engineering trends and technologies through activities... 
    Minimum wage
    Ongoing contract
    H1b
    Local area
    Remote work
    Worldwide
    Relocation

    ZOLL Medical

    Broomfield, CO
    3 days ago
  • $111.21k - $155.7k

    Ground Software Engineer II - Lunar Permanence page is loaded## Ground Software...  ..., you will help build, test, and integrate the software...  ...Origin operations, including flight/ground system integration and...  ...test, package, and deployment automation* Experience with test automation... 
    Permanent employment
    Temporary work
    Local area

    Blue Origin

    Denver, CO
    1 day ago
  • $105.53k - $145.11k

     ...extraordinary team. About the Role The Software Engineer II role involves designing, developing, and testing software applications for space systems and technologies...  ...scripting languages (Bash, PowerShell) and automation tools (Ansible) Strong analytical skills,... 
    Contract work
    Work experience placement

    Sierra Space Corporation

    Louisville, CO
    1 day ago

Do you want to receive more vacancies?

Subscribe and receive similar vacancies to Senior Flight Software Engineer II - Automation & Test. Be the first to apply!